draw

gb/dɹˈɔ/ us/dɹˈɔ/
A1 İngilizce
~ 500
rajzol, húz, vonz, kivált, magára vonja a figyelmet, kinyer, merít, vért vesz, döntetlen
FIIL A1
1
Kullanım kalıbı:
to draw [something]
She likes to draw portraits of her friends.
Szeret portrékat rajzolni a barátairól.
The architect drew a plan for the new building.
Az építész tervet rajzolt az új épülethez.
He drew a map to help us find the park.
Öğrenenler için örnekler
I can draw a cat.
Tudok macskát rajzolni.
She draws pictures every day.
Mindennap képeket rajzol.
He draws a tree on the paper.
Sık yapılan hata:
Learners sometimes confuse 'draw' with 'paint', but 'paint' uses colors and brushes while 'draw' uses lines from pens or pencils.
Anlam
Make a picture with pen or pencil
Eşdizimler
draw a picture |draw a line |draw a map |draw a sketch
Eş anlamlılar
sketch (Often suggests a quick or rough drawing rather than a finished work.)
Zıt anlamlılar
erase (To remove or delete marks rather than create them.)
Konular
art |daily life |arts_entertainment |education |core_vocabulary
Tanım

To make a picture by using a pen or pencil on paper.

To create an image or diagram by making lines and marks on a surface, typically using a pen, pencil, or similar tool.

FIIL A2
2
Kullanım kalıbı:
to draw [something] [towards/closer/out]
She drew the curtains to block the sunlight.
Behúzta a függönyt, hogy ne süssön be a nap.
He drew his chair closer to the table.
Közelebb húzta a székét az asztalhoz.
The knight drew his sword from its sheath.
Öğrenenler için örnekler
I draw the chair to the desk.
Odahúzom a széket az íróasztalhoz.
She draws the door closed.
Behúzza az ajtót.
He draws the box near.
Sık yapılan hata:
Learners may overuse 'pull' instead of 'draw' in set expressions like 'draw the curtains'.
Anlam
Pull something toward you or in a direction
Eşdizimler
draw the curtains |draw a bow |draw someone closer
Eş anlamlılar
pull (General term for moving something toward oneself; 'draw' can sound slightly more formal or deliberate.)
Zıt anlamlılar
push (To move something away from oneself instead of toward.)
Konular
daily life |daily_life |core_vocabulary
Tanım

To pull something closer to you or to another place.

To cause something to move toward oneself or toward a particular position by applying force, often using the hands or arms.

FIIL B1
3
Kullanım kalıbı:
to draw [attention/interest] [to/towards] [something]
The speaker's joke drew laughter from the audience.
A szónok vicce nevetést váltott ki a közönségből.
The bright colors drew my attention immediately.
Az élénk színek azonnal magukra vonták a figyelmemet.
The report drew criticism from experts.
Öğrenenler için örnekler
The music draws many people.
A zene sok embert vonz.
Her dress draws my eyes.
A ruhája vonzza a tekintetemet.
The news draws attention from the public.
Sık yapılan hata:
Learners might confuse 'draw attention' with 'pay attention', which means to focus on something yourself.
Anlam
Attract attention or interest
Eşdizimler
draw attention |draw interest |draw criticism
Eş anlamlılar
attract (A general term for gaining attention; 'draw' is often used in fixed expressions like 'draw attention'.)
Zıt anlamlılar
distract (To take attention away from something rather than bring it toward it.)
Konular
communication |core_vocabulary
Tanım

To make people look at or think about something.

To cause someone to notice or become interested in something.

FIIL B1
4
Kullanım kalıbı:
to draw [liquid/gas/energy] [from something]
They drew water from the well every morning.
Minden reggel vizet merítettek a kútból.
The nurse drew blood for testing.
A nővér vért vett a vizsgálathoz.
The machine draws power from the main generator.
Öğrenenler için örnekler
He draws water from the river.
Vizet merít a folyóból.
The doctor draws blood from my arm.
Az orvos vért vesz a karomból.
The car draws power from the battery.
Anlam
Take liquid, gas, or energy from source
Eşdizimler
draw water from a well |draw blood |draw power
Eş anlamlılar
extract (More formal; often used in scientific contexts for taking something out of another material.)
Zıt anlamlılar
supply (To give or provide something rather than take it.)
Konular
science |daily life |core_vocabulary
Tanım

To take liquid, gas, energy, or other material from where it is kept.

To remove or extract liquid, gas, energy, or another substance from its source.

İSIM A2
5
The match ended in a draw after extra time.
A mérkőzés hosszabbítás után döntetlennel végződött.
They played to a 1–1 draw.
1–1-es döntetlent játszottak.
It was the team's third draw of the season.
Öğrenenler için örnekler
The game is a draw.
Döntetlen a meccs.
We end with a draw.
Döntetlennel zárunk.
It was a 2–2 draw.
Anlam
Game ending in no winner
Eşdizimler
end in a draw |play to a draw
Eş anlamlılar
tie ('Tie' is more common in American English; 'draw' is more common in British English.)
Zıt anlamlılar
victory (A result where one side wins instead of neither side winning.)
Konular
sports |core_vocabulary
Tanım

When two players or teams have the same score, so there is no winner.

A situation in a game or competition where both sides finish with the same score and no one wins.

Dil bilgisi
Sözlük biçimi
draw
IPA
GB/dɹˈɔ/
US/dɹˈɔ/
Heceler ve vurgu
draw (1 hece)
Stress on 1st syllable (draw)
Kelime biçimleri
Noun
  • Base: draw
  • Plural: draws
Verb
  • Base: draw
  • 3rd Person Singular: draws
  • Present Participle: drawing
  • Past: drew
  • Past Participle: drawn
Kelime ailesi
Forms
draws noun drawing verb drew verb drawn verb
Related words
drawer noun A2 redraw verb
Advanced or less common
withdraw verb A2 withdrawal noun B1
Öne çıkanlar
  • Irregular past: drew Verb
  • Irregular past participle: drawn Verb
İfadeler

draw out

1
/dɹˈɔ ˈaʊt/
phrasal verb

Make something last longer than usual

To make something continue longer than needed.

Örnekler
  • He tried to draw out the conversation to avoid going back to work.
  • The teacher drew out the lesson with extra examples.

draw the line (at)

1
/dɹˈɔ ðə lˈaɪn ˈæt/
idiom

Set a limit you will not cross

To say you will not allow something to happen beyond a certain point.

Örnekler
  • I don’t mind helping, but I draw the line at doing your homework for you.
  • We have to draw the line somewhere when it comes to spending.

draw up

1
/dɹˈɔ ˈʌp/
phrasal verb

Prepare document or plan in writing

To write an official paper or plan.

Örnekler
  • They drew up a contract before starting work.
  • The lawyer will draw up your will.

short straw (draw the)

1
/ʃˈɔɹt stɹˈɔ dɹˈɔ ðə/
idiom informal

Be chosen for an unwanted task by chance

To be picked by chance to do something unpleasant.

Örnekler
  • I drew the short straw and had to clean up after the party.
  • Whoever draws the short straw has to do the dishes.

draw attention to

1
/dɹˈɔ ətˈɛnʃən tə/
phrasal verb

make others notice something

To make people see or know about something.

Örnekler
  • She wore a bright dress to draw attention to herself.
  • The report draws attention to the need for better safety measures.

draw attention to

2
/dɹˈɔ ətˈɛnʃən tə/
phrasal verb

Cause people to notice something specific

To make people see or think about something.

Örnekler
  • The teacher drew attention to the mistake on the board.
  • The article draws attention to climate change issues.
